The heart behind Tamika

Tamika brings medication and health records together with conversation and the joy of growing a garden and caring for fish.

I hope it can ease a little of the burden of treatment and bring small moments of joy to everyday life. But I did not begin with such a broad ambition. I started making this app simply because I wanted to help my mother.

In May 2026, my mother, Tamiko, was diagnosed with stage 4 colorectal cancer. After surgery, she began chemotherapy.

She worked hard to write about her health and treatment in the diary she had received from the hospital. But side effects, including numbness in her hands, made writing difficult. Eventually, the entries stopped.

I wanted my mother to be able to record
her day in her own words.

Even if writing by hand was difficult, perhaps an app could help. That thought led me to create a way for everyday conversation to become a record of the day.

There are days when even talking feels difficult. On better days, it can be easy to forget medication or to make a note.

I wanted to make an app people would naturally want to open, on either kind of day.

Perhaps a pleasant conversation brings you back for a little chat. Or you wonder how much your vegetables or fish have grown and come to see them. While you are there, you can check your medication or leave a small note about your day.

And it is okay to have days when you cannot open the app. Your plants will not wither if you do not visit every day.

I hope Tamika can be a companion in the everyday lives of people going through treatment.
